Paperwhites (Narcissus papyraceus) are a popular variety of the Narcissus genus, known for their intensely fragrant, pure white blossoms. Native to the warm Mediterranean region, these bulbs are unique because they do not require a period of cold dormancy, known as chilling, to initiate flowering. This characteristic makes them a favorite for “forcing” indoors, allowing enjoyment of springtime scent and color during winter. The ease with which these bulbs sprout and bloom in simple containers of water and pebbles or soil has cemented their status as a staple for holiday decorating.
The Duration of the Blooming Period
The immediate lifespan of a Paperwhite is the duration of its flowers. Typically, a single bulb provides a display that lasts for approximately two to three weeks under average indoor conditions. The bloom period begins once the clusters of small, star-like flowers fully emerge from their protective sheaths and open.
The bulb contains all the stored energy required for flowering, meaning the growing medium does not significantly alter the overall bloom time. The total length of the display depends on how quickly the individual florets mature and fade. Once the flowers on the scape have finished their cycle, the display is over, though the foliage may persist briefly.
Environmental Factors That Extend Bloom Life
Controlling the immediate environment is the most effective way to maximize the weeks of enjoyment from the flowers. Temperature is a significant factor in extending the bloom period, as cooler air slows down the plant’s metabolic processes. Keeping the flowering plant in a cool location, ideally between 60 and 65 degrees Fahrenheit, can help stretch the bloom time, sometimes up to four weeks.
The location should receive bright, indirect light to support the foliage without causing the flowers to wilt prematurely. Direct, intense sunlight, especially through a window, can quickly scorch the delicate white petals and shorten the lifespan of the blooms. Consistent moisture in the growing medium is necessary, but careful watering avoids the primary threat of bulb rot, which would prematurely end the display.
A specific technique to improve the longevity and appearance of the flowers is the use of a diluted alcohol solution in place of pure water. Research has shown that watering the bulbs with a solution of approximately 4-6% alcohol, such as diluted vodka or gin, stunts the growth of the stem. This controlled growth results in shorter, sturdier flower stalks that are less likely to flop over under the weight of the blooms. Preventing the stems from bending or breaking maintains the structural integrity of the display, indirectly preserving the flowers.
Reblooming Possibilities
While the Paperwhite bulb is botanically a perennial plant, the context of indoor forcing significantly impacts its long-term viability. The process of forcing an early bloom indoors requires the bulb to expend nearly all its stored carbohydrate energy to produce the flowers and foliage. After the initial bloom, the bulb is largely exhausted and lacks the resources to flower again soon.
For this reason, Paperwhites that have been forced in water or soil indoors are typically treated as annuals and discarded once the flowers fade. Though some experienced gardeners attempt to save the bulbs, the energy reserves are insufficient to guarantee a successful rebloom indoors the following winter. The bulb would require an extended period of active growth and fertilization to replenish its stores, which is difficult to achieve in a typical indoor setting.
The only reliable way to achieve future blooms is to plant the bulbs outdoors in a suitable, mild climate. Paperwhites are hardy only in USDA Zones 8 through 10, where they can be planted in the ground to naturalize. Even when planted in these ideal conditions after being forced, it often takes two to three years for the bulb to regain enough energy from the soil and sun to resume its natural perennial flowering cycle.
